Life is filled with circumstances beyond our control. But while we can’t always prevent what happens to us, we do have power over how we respond to those events, including the especially challenging or difficult ones. Maya Angelou spoke at length about this sort of empowerment and inner strength. Her work often dealt with finding the power to rise above tragedy and distress, stepping into our personal agency, and choosing not to be diminished or defined by the hardships we face. Remaining conscious of our own attitude and outlook in the face of whatever comes our way is somewhat of a personal superpower: It allows us to stand strong, maintain our dignity and self-worth, and deny external forces the ability to limit our potential.
